Всего: 2 1 2 >
 Подскажите правильную настройку модуля Qiwi
27NataRUS


Cпециалист
: 105
: 18-07-2013


13-11-2013 14:27
Модуль отсюда http://prestalab.ru/moduli-oplaty/1-modul-oplaty-qiwi.html
В папке с файлами модуля нет таких адресов, как в приложенном скриншоте №1.
Есть файлы validation.php и success.php по пути /modules/qiwi/controllers/front/, но при прописывании и сохранении пути в админке, обновляются и встают дефолтные.
При попытке оплаты пишет, что Агента не существует в системе. Как ошибки исправлять?



:
настройки модуля.png - 36.97KB, : 514 () ошибка оплаты.png - 21.91KB, : 500 ()
 
  
avpet
Cпециалист
: 154
: 26-10-2011


13-11-2013 18:11
Есть мнение, что телефон должен быть 10 символов а не 11
 
  
slava_210
Новичок
: 41
: Луцк
: 25-08-2013


13-11-2013 19:21
да, попробуйте 11 символов ставить... модуль должен нормально работать... у вас какая версия престы?
 
  
27NataRUS


Cпециалист
: 105
: 18-07-2013


13-11-2013 22:25
Я не знаю, где ставить количество символов номера телефона. У меня вообще они с +3 должны начинаться, а подставляет +7.
И пути урлов в настройках модуля смущают. Нет у меня таких путей. http://amkita.com/ru/module/qiwi/validation
http://amkita.com/ru/module/qiwi/success
http://amkita.com/ru/index.html?controller=order&step=3
Преста 1.5.4.1
 
  
avpet
Cпециалист
: 154
: 26-10-2011


14-11-2013 10:45
modules/qiwi/views/templates/front/redirect.tpl
Примерно 32-ая строка +7 заменить на +3. Или на то что у вас есть.

modules/qiwi/controllers/front/redirect.php
Проверьте функцию function initContent()
там как раз идёт удаление кода телефона. т.е. функция сделана для России удаляет +7 или 8, переделайте под себя.




Сообщение отредактировано avpet 14-11-2013 09:46 ...
 
  
27NataRUS


Cпециалист
: 105
: 18-07-2013


14-11-2013 11:25
Цитата:( avpet @ 14-11-2013 07:45 Смотреть сообщение )
modules/qiwi/views/templates/front/redirect.tpl
Примерно 32-ая строка +7 заменить на +3. Или на то что у вас есть.

modules/qiwi/controllers/front/redirect.php
Проверьте функцию function initContent()
там как раз идёт удаление кода телефона. т.е. функция сделана для России удаляет +7 или 8, переделайте под себя.

Спасибо большое, сейчас попробую.
А как-нибудь можно вовсе не проверять номер телефона, чтобы подставлялся тот номер, что пользователь указал при создании адреса?
 
  
avpet
Cпециалист
: 154
: 26-10-2011


14-11-2013 11:28
Можно, убрав проверки, но киви требует наличия формата номера + и т.д. если с этим порядок, то почему нет)
 
  
27NataRUS


Cпециалист
: 105
: 18-07-2013


14-11-2013 11:33
Поменяла цифру, теперь во фрейме открывается страница qiwi с Ошибкой: Магазин не найден.
 
  
27NataRUS


Cпециалист
: 105
: 18-07-2013


14-11-2013 11:36
А на электропочту пришло сообщение о выставлении счёта.
От Вас к 77499312071 выставлен счёт № 8 на сумму 488,59 . Комментарий: Payment for cart # 8
 
  
avpet
Cпециалист
: 154
: 26-10-2011


14-11-2013 11:49
+3 по коду это кто? Мне кажется что АПИ на qiwi может не принимать формат номера начинающийся на +3. Может быть код не +3 а больше? какой формат номера?
 
  
   
Всего: 2 1 2 >